Title: Amending Chapter 88, Code of Ordinances, by repealing Section 88-605-03, Street Naming Committee, and enacting in lieu thereof a new section of like number and subject matter for the purpose of requiring City Council approval for the renaming of streets.

BE IT ORDAINED BY THE COUNCIL OF KANSAS CITY:

Section 1. That Chapter 88, Code of Ordinances, is hereby amended by repealing Section 88-605-03, Street Naming, and enacting in lieu thereof a new section of like number and subject matter, to read as follows:

88-605-03 - STREET NAMING COMMITTEE

88-605-03-A. ESTABLISHMENT AND PURPOSE
There is hereby established a street naming committee with the prime function of assigning names to the public and private streets.

88-605-03-B. MEMBERSHIP
The following individuals are members of the street naming committee:

1. city planning and development director;

2. public works director;

3. parks and recreation director;

4. fire chief;

5. police chief.

88-605-03-C. EX OFFICIO MEMBERS
The following are ex officio members of the street naming committee:

1. U.S. post office; and

2. other agencies as deemed necessary by the city planning and development director to render a complete and competent review of proposed street names.

88-605-03-D. PROCEDURES
The city planning and development director is the chairperson of the street naming committee. The chair's function is to coordinate committee activities. The committee shall review requests to rename streets and make recommendations to the city council when needed. The committee shall assign street names as part of the subdivision plat approval process. The chair must inform the developer of recommendations by the committee and must present recommendations to the city plan commission or the city council, as necessary.
